Just like most of the above-mentioned, alternative cannabinoids, HHC is found in the hemp plant, but it is in limited quantities. When researchers found that HHC could be synthesized from CBD in a lab, this made the larger-scale production of this naturally occurring cannabinoid feasible. 

What is HHC cannabinoid and how does it compare to THC?

Hexahydro cannabinol (aka HHC) is a relative of Delta 9 THC, however chemically it is slightly different from THC since it includes a hydrogen molecule.  Basically, in a nutshell (or in a gummy) it is hydrogenated Delta 9 THC.  Delta 9 THC is the psychoactive cannabinoid that is most commonly referred to as weed, marijuana, cannabis, ganja, reefer, etc.  When the hydrogen molecule is added to the Delta-9 THC, it becomes a new compound, known as HHC.

Is HHC Legal? 

HHC is a cannabinoid that comes from hemp plants. It was created through an extraction process, much like CBD oil; however, it begins with the compound THC which goes through a process of hydrogenation. Hydrogenation of THC is successfully completed from a chemical saturation of the hydrogen atoms.

The atoms are exposed to a nickel or zinc catalyst, which converts into HHC. The additional hydrogen atoms for HHC allow the compound to be more stable and to have a longer shelf-life compared to THC. Due to the fact that this process begins with federally compliant hemp plants, it falls under the current legal guidelines of the 2018 Farm Bill.
